SUPERB: CLASSIC: INDISPENSABLE: NEW First Yale Nota Bene Edition (0rig. 1977) 11th Printing (c. 1998): NEW handsomely designed matte-gloss laminated card-stock cover, NEW uncreased binding, IMMACCULATE smooth-cut text-block exterior, PRISTINE interior han…dsomely printed on SUPERB archival paper * 6.0" x 9.24" x 1.16", 0.49 kg, xx+588 (608) pp. * Winner of the Ninth Annual James Russell Lowell Prize of the Modern Language Association * ABOUT THE BOOK: This prize-winning work provides a facsimile of the 1609 Quarto printed in parallel with a conservatively edited, modernized text, as well as a commentary that ranges from brief glosses to substantial critical essays. Stephen booth's notes help a modern reader toward the kind of understanding that Renaissance readers brought to the works. * HIGHEST PRASE: "This edition of the sonnets is a heroic enterprise. . . . [Booth's] annotation does far more than any previous edition to show the fantastically rich way that Shakespeare exploits the verbal resources of his culture. . . . No serious reader of the sonnets will want to do without Booth's edition." - C.L. Barber, NYRB "Booth's edition, like Shakespeare's sonnets, is something of a miracle. Hs extensive commentary, like the poems it describes, is a dazzling commixture of intricate detail, multiplicity, bombast, bawdy, suppleness, and grandeur. . . .
